Retention Rates

Importance of Retention Rates

Retention rates are a critical metric in assessing the success of a game app. High retention rates indicate that users are continuing to engage with the app over time, which is essential for long-term revenue generation. Conversely, low retention rates can lead to decreased user acquisition and revenue.

Factors Influencing Retention

Several factors can influence retention rates, including:

  • Gameplay: The gameplay experience can significantly impact retention rates. Engaging and enjoyable gameplay can keep users coming back for more, while a lackluster experience can cause users to churn.
  • User Experience: A positive user experience can contribute to higher retention rates. This includes factors such as intuitive navigation, smooth performance, and visually appealing graphics.
  • Social Interaction: Social interaction within a game app can encourage users to return to the app. Features such as leaderboards, in-game chat, and multiplayer modes can all contribute to higher retention rates.

Strategies for Improving Retention

To improve retention rates, game app developers can consider implementing the following strategies:

  • Personalization: Personalizing the user experience can help increase retention rates. This can include personalized recommendations, customized challenges, and tailored rewards.
  • Gamification: Gamification elements such as rewards, badges, and challenges can encourage users to return to the app.
  • Event-based Content: Introducing event-based content such as limited-time challenges or in-game events can create a sense of urgency and encourage users to return to the app.
  • Push Notifications: Strategically timed push notifications can remind users to return to the app and encourage continued engagement.

Overall, understanding the factors that influence retention rates and implementing effective retention strategies can help game app developers improve user engagement and drive long-term revenue growth.

  • The Winning Game App
    • Game Title: Candy Crush Saga
    • Developer: King
    • Launch Date: November 2012
    • Platforms: iOS, Android, Windows Phone, Facebook
    • Game Description: Candy Crush Saga is a free-to-play match-three puzzle video game. The player progresses through various levels by swapping adjacent candies to create sets of three, which then disappear. New candies are introduced as the game progresses, such as wrapped and striped candies that have special properties. The game is designed to be played in short sessions, as levels become increasingly difficult.
